Shawnigan Lake School Magazine CRICKET THE cricket team had a good season. Five matches were played of which four Avere won and one drawn. Owing to the war no fixtures were possible with Cowichan or Victoria clubs, but two enjoyable games were played with the Royal Air Force. Matches were also arranged with the Royal Australian Air Force, but unfor- tunately these had to be cancelled at the last minute. Much of the success of the team Avas due to good fielding and to the captaincy of Wheeler, who managed his bowlers well and showed good judgment in the placing of his fieldsmen. We had a potentially strong batting side, but except in the Brentwood match our scores were rather disappointing. Fortunately, however, the bowling was stronger than usual and was never mastered by any of our oppon- ents. During the second game with the Royal Air Force, Forrest achieved the rare feat of taking all ten wickets in an innings. 1st CRICKET ELEVEN, 1942 Back row: P. B. Ballentine, E. R. Larsen, R. A. Shawnigan Lake School Magazine the shoes on his feet are heelless. He advances to the president ' s box, makes a formal bow and turns to face his adversary. The crowd leans forward as he throws his hat into the air and ap- proaches the bull bareheaded. His sole armament is an estoque or heavy flat-bladed sword. As the bull charges the matador deftly waves his eapa or bright red cloak until the animal is in position. With lightning speed he now delivers the last stroke, a thrust through the back of the neck close to the head and downward into the heart. The kill is, indeed, a most difficult movement to perform and the matador ' s skill is greeted with shouts of acclaim. He makes a tour of honour and acknoAvledges the applause as the slain animal is dragged from the arena. Attendants now cover the bloodstains with sand in preparation for the next fight. Every Sunday in Lima, Peru, at the Plaza del Toros you will find Spaniards and natives indulging in their favourite recreation of watching a bullfight. The public has not yet recognized as abhorrent those features of bull-baiting so repellent to the people of other countries. — K. G. R. [ 18 ]
